Output e950279d7f2b0bbca805628e4fb6b62046c5bd0de1a0da75579caa2fc47fd4c8:0

value
18129868
script pubkey
OP_0 OP_PUSHBYTES_32 a1fd715f5115852e5e2fb7bb464e3de34287fc60e4eb344359781cbdf6920021
address
bc1q587hzh63zkzjuh30k7a5vn3audpg0lrqun4ngs6e0qwtma5jqqssvtjs6d
transaction
e950279d7f2b0bbca805628e4fb6b62046c5bd0de1a0da75579caa2fc47fd4c8
confirmations
1569
spent
true